Sim chats to Manisha Sheth, Pregnancy and Birth Coach, about her experience of a quarter life crisis that was triggered by parenthood. They talk about the unrealistic expectations of ‘feeling complete’ once you have children, how our conditioning becomes our own voice and how your past experiences can give you a clue about what might feel more fulfilling in your life right now.
